Knitting Stitch

Description:

A knitting stitch refers to a basic unit of knitting, usually forming a loop that is passed through other loops to create a fabric. There are numerous types of knitting stitches, each with unique characteristics and uses, allowing knitters to create intricate patterns and textures in their projects.
